So, 'Guerilla' is a pretty interesting piece from 2011. It crafts this eerie atmosphere where you almost feel the tension as a bus suddenly stops. Then, these shadowy figures in black bring an inflatable gorilla to life, which is quite the sight. The pacing is deliberately slow, letting the tension build as the gorilla stomps through an industrial landscape, and what's fascinating is how the environment reacts—plants and animals springing out in response to this chaotic energy. It really explores themes of nature versus industrialization. The practical effects are striking for an animation, and there's a rawness in the execution that gives it a unique edge. It's got a distinct vibe that sticks with you.
